Description
During Chinese President Jiang Zemin’s visit to Cambodia in November 2000, the Chinese Government and the Government of Cambodia signed at least six agreements, of which one was an Economic and Technical Cooperation Agreement (ETCA) to give 100 million yuan assistance to Cambodia. Among this 100 million yuan assistance, 50 million yuan was a grant (as captured in this project), and the remaining 50 million yuan was from an interest-free loan (as captured in linked ProjectID#32022). One official (who spoke on the condition of anonymity) explained that the aid might go help export soybeans to China, bring rice seed to Cambodia, or help facilitate Chinese investment in Cambodian factories.RMB 45 million was provided for Cambodia's Phase 1 of Steel Bridge Materials Project (as captured in linked ProjectID#32037)RMB 5 million went toward Cambodia's Water Well Drilling Project (as captured in linked ProjectID#32040)
